Output 3a4407c75106622a81a09369d8c522bfaf66f008bb1e63226c8690a9fe146e1f:3

value
590877
script pubkey
OP_0 OP_PUSHBYTES_20 98ba1bfd687bbd7c77e6825055dc7bab4b71d62e
address
bc1qnzaphltg0w7hcalxsfg9thrm4d9hr43w2du8ux
transaction
3a4407c75106622a81a09369d8c522bfaf66f008bb1e63226c8690a9fe146e1f